Home > Python Exception > Python For Syntax Error

Python For Syntax Error

Contents

The exceptions are defined in the module exceptions. try: ... Handling Exceptions 8.4. Predefined Clean-up Actions Previous topic 7. http://caribtechsxm.com/python-exception/python-syntax-error.php

def __init__(self, value): ... The Python Software Foundation is a non-profit corporation. Handling Exceptions¶ It is possible to write programs that handle selected exceptions. Kent D.

Python Exception Class

Next Day Video 32.807 weergaven 27:05 Python3 Beginner Tutorial 3 - Input & Output - Duur: 9:49. All user-defined exceptions should also be derived from this class. EOL stands for End Of Line. except ZeroDivisionError as detail: ...

  1. exception UserWarning¶ Base class for warnings generated by user code.
  2. Handling Exceptions¶ It is possible to write programs that handle selected exceptions.
  3. Misuse of parentheses for multiplication Which lane to enter on this roundabout? (UK) Does the Many Worlds interpretation of quantum mechanics necessarily imply every world exist?
  4. I may have missed the reasoning for this in an earlier lesson, but any input would be appreciated.
  5. Raising Exceptions¶ The raise statement allows the programmer to force a specified exception to occur.
  6. mark http://www.themagpi.com/ Reply wobsta says: July 12, 2012 at 8:53 am My favorite error is not in your list: i = 0 print "number: %d" % i+1 results in TypeError: cannot
  7. File name and line number are printed so you know where to look in case the input came from a script. 8.2.
  8. Sluiten Ja, nieuwe versie behouden Ongedaan maken Sluiten Deze video is niet beschikbaar.
  9. Name Error This will be a common error you encounter.

exception PendingDeprecationWarning¶ Base class for warnings about features which will be deprecated in the future. If you modify your code to work something like the below example, you will be more easily able to see where there are problems.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Invalid Syntax For Loop Python except ZeroDivisionError: ...

The new behavior simply creates the value attribute. Bezig... Join them; it only takes a minute: Sign up Invalid syntax in “for item in L” loop up vote 4 down vote favorite I have a feeling I'm missing something pretty But the above is for the very legitimate case where you need the index in the body of the loop, rather than just the value itself." In that case, `for i,

Kies je taal. Python Exception Stack Trace exception BufferError¶ Raised when a buffer related operation cannot be performed. In general it contains a stack traceback listing source lines; however, it will not display lines read from standard input. more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ed

Python Exception Message

this_fails() ... https://docs.python.org/3/tutorial/errors.html Exception handlers don't just handle exceptions if they occur immediately in the try clause, but also if they occur inside functions that are called (even indirectly) in the try clause. Python Exception Class More information on defining exceptions is available in the Python Tutorial under User-defined Exceptions. Python Custom Exception This is not an issue in simple scripts, but can be a problem for larger applications.

Defining Clean-up Actions 8.7. news In general it contains a stack traceback listing source lines; however, it will not display lines read from standard input. print inst.args # arguments stored in .args ... Toggle navigation The “Invent with Python” Blog 16 Common Python Runtime Errors Beginners Find July 9, 2012July 10, 2012 Al Sweigart Uncategorized Figuring out what Python's error messages mean can be Python Raise Valueerror

The try statement works as follows. Inloggen Delen Meer Rapporteren Wil je een melding indienen over de video? New in version 2.3. have a peek at these guys Thanks for the help. 1382 points Submitted by 杰里米 over 4 years ago 0 votes permalink No problem! ;) Glad I could help. 3277 points Submitted by Raph over 4 years

In real world applications, the finally clause is useful for releasing external resources (such as files or network connections), regardless of whether the use of the resource was successful. 8.7. Python Invalid Syntax Range The TypeError raised by dividing two strings is not handled by the except clause and therefore re-raised after the finally clause has been executed. Getting Coveo configured properly in a CD/CM server setup Words that are anagrams of themselves Why don't browser DNS caches mitigate DDOS attacks on DNS providers?

Exceptions should typically be derived from the Exception class, either directly or indirectly.

Course Forum Section 1 Print Syntax Functions Forum View Course 194 points Submitted by delarsen5 over 2 years ago Print Syntax Good Afternoon, I've started to program the challenges alongside the exception ReferenceError¶ This exception is raised when a weak reference proxy, created by the weakref.proxy() function, is used to access an attribute of the referent after it has been garbage Handling Exceptions 8.4. Python Print Exception pass The last except clause may omit the exception name(s), to serve as a wildcard.

It has significantly reduced the time I spend fixing run time errors. Consider the following example: apples = 0
pickedApples = input("Pick some apples: ")
apples = apples + pickedApples
pickedApples = input("Pick some more apples: ")
apples = apples + pickedApples
print Click here to learn more. check my blog Python will attempt to highlight the offending line in your source code.

break ... Reply Paul says: July 9, 2012 at 6:30 pm About number 3, mixing tabs and spaces is a common cause. Table Of Contents 8. exception WindowsError¶ Raised when a Windows-specific error occurs or when the error number does not correspond to an errno value.

this_fails() ... You simply define a variable by its name, like num = range(1, 6) in this case. print 'y =', y ... ('spam', 'eggs') ('spam', 'eggs') x = spam y = eggs If an exception has an argument, it is printed as the last part (‘detail') This forum is now read-only.

For example: >>> class MyError(Exception): ... with open("myfile.txt") as f: for line in f: print line, After the statement is executed, the file f is always closed, even if a problem was encountered while processing the lines. for i, x in enumerate(container): ...